WebHieroglyphics is a writing system invented in Egypt around 5000 years ago. It is the second oldest form of writing, originating a few hundred years after cuneiform, which uses wedge-shaped characters and was devised by the Sumarians of Mesopotamia. Web15 de mar. de 2024 · Origins of Egyptian Hieroglyphs. The ancient Egyptians believed that writing was invented by the god Thoth and called their hieroglyphic script " mdju netjer " ("words of the gods").
